What is the basic structure of a family tree?

A family tree starts with a common ancestor at the top or center, branching downward or outward to show descendants. It includes parents, children, siblings, and extended relatives, typically organized by generations to visually represent relationships and lineage over time.

Who played Max's brother in Stranger Things Season 2?

Max's brother Billy is played by Dacre Montgomery in Stranger Things Season 2. His abusive, rebellious character adds tension to the show's Upside Down mysteries and family dynamics in Hawkins.

Does health insurance cover laser eye surgery?

Most health insurance plans do not cover LASIK as it's elective, but vision insurance or FSA/HSA funds often apply. Some providers offer discounts; verify with your policy for partial coverage on PRK or other corrective procedures.
